[opensuse-buildservice] samba 4 build fails due to shlib-policy-name-error
Hi, we get at the moment a badness of 10000 due to the old, legacy packaging of /%{_lib}/libnss_winbind.so.2 in the samba-client package for the network:samba:TESTING/samba project. We package the same in network:samba:STABLE/samba and there all works as it does since quite some time. From the log of 12.1 in TESTING: [ 1846s] samba-client.i586: E: shlib-policy-name-error (Badness: 10000) libnss_wins2 [ 1846s] Your package contains a single shared library but is not named after its [ 1846s] SONAME. In STABLE we see no Error at all. I'm posting this with intention to both, the packaging and buildservice list, as the arguments and reasoning might be of help to the other side too. I feel a bit uncomfortable to see RHEL and CentOS 6 builds in succeeded state while we have no good results for SUSE build targets. Cheers, Lars -- Lars Müller [ˈlaː(r)z ˈmʏlɐ] Samba Team + SUSE Labs SUSE Linux, Maxfeldstraße 5, 90409 Nürnberg, Germany
On Fri, Dec 07, 2012 at 08:45:53PM +0100, Lars Müller wrote:
we get at the moment a badness of 10000 due to the old, legacy packaging of /%{_lib}/libnss_winbind.so.2 in the samba-client package for the network:samba:TESTING/samba project.
[ 8< ] To circumvent this issue we use at the moment setBadness('shlib-policy-name-error', 0) in network:samba:TESTING/samba/samba-client-rpmlintrc That's not elegant but for now it works. This defenitly needs more investigation. In particular as the same package sources fail with the same error when used inside network:samba:STABLE/samba Cheers, Lars -- Lars Müller [ˈlaː(r)z ˈmʏlɐ] Samba Team + SUSE Labs SUSE Linux, Maxfeldstraße 5, 90409 Nürnberg, Germany
participants (1)
-
Lars Müller